I was thinking about the passport and nationality issue, and for practical reasons, we should create a supra-nationality, like that of the EU, that does not replace the previous nationality, but comes over it and acts as a sense of unity for those citizens from various cultural and geographical backgrounds.

As any country or organization, JREFLand also needs a flag, capital (or HQ) and possibly anthem too.

The anthem does not have to be original or composed by us. The EU's national anthem is Beethoven's 9th symphony, for example. We could choose one from classical music. Beethoven was chosen for his Europeanness (his roots are in Belgium, but he was born in Germany and lived and worked mostly in Austria, while supporting the ideals of the French Revolution). As most people have only one nationality, and most classical composers are European, it may be easier to select the music based on the feelings it conveys (Beethoven's 9th symphony was chosen because it is based on Schiller's Ode to Joy (http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ode_to_Joy) that refers to the brotherhood between humans around the world).

I was thinking (without much reflection) about Dvorak's 9th symphony From the New World (http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Symphony_No._9_%28Dvorak%29), which is the most international music I know in inspirations (read article in link), and is futuristic in its approach.
